Mirror, Mirror
She's a ghost floating in skin,
with grey eyes
weathered from sin.
The hair on her head,
is brown from mopping the
dirt of others.
She has fragile bones that so beautifully
cut through the hearts of lovers.
She's a dreamer, but certainly not a believer.
She looks in the mirror
Everyday
Until she becomes a ghost.
See through her.
